Transaction 3a9d3aebcd99647490c3f72601747013af4095807618f4b8cfb8408f94819e0e

1 Input
1 Outputs
  • 3a9d3aebcd99647490c3f72601747013af4095807618f4b8cfb8408f94819e0e:0
  • value  127683
    address  34TozpKMjjtzwxrN9QGa5CBMtZt4iWeERN